fre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

紅外遙控編碼格式及學(xué)習(xí)模式含程序-在線瀏覽

2025-02-23 20:50本頁面
  

【正文】 實例是已知NEC類型遙控器所截獲的波形:遙控器的識別碼是Address=0xDD20。所以0000,0100,1011,1011反轉(zhuǎn)過來就是1101,1101,0010,000十六進(jìn)制的DD20;鍵值波形如下:也是要將0111,0000反轉(zhuǎn)成0000,1110得到十六進(jìn)制的0E;另外注意8位的鍵值代碼是取反后再發(fā)一次的,如圖0111,0000 取反后為1000,1111。RC5編碼相對簡單一些:同樣由于取自紅外接收頭的波形需要反相一下波形以便于分析:反相后的波形:第三位是控制位C 它在每按下了一個鍵后翻轉(zhuǎn),這樣就可以區(qū)分一個鍵到底是一直按著沒松手還是松手后重復(fù)按。其后是五個系統(tǒng)地址位:11010=1A最后是六個命令位:001101=0D參考:00000000000000000000000000000000000000000000000000000000000000000000紅外線遙控器軟件解碼程序(能解大部分遙控器的編碼)作者:佚名 錄入:Admin 點(diǎn)擊數(shù):3 【字體: 】,跟著引導(dǎo)碼是系統(tǒng)碼,系統(tǒng)反碼,按鍵碼,按鍵反碼,如果按著鍵不放,則遙控器則發(fā)送一段重復(fù)碼,重復(fù)碼由9ms的高電平,跟著是一個短脈沖,本程序是免費(fèi)給大家,版權(quán)所有,不得用于商業(yè)目的,如需用到本程序到商業(yè)上請與本人聯(lián)系經(jīng)本人同意后方可用于商業(yè)目的,本程序經(jīng)過試用,能解大部分遙控器的編碼!includedefine0x00//數(shù)據(jù)無效defineREQUEST0X02//請求信號defineNACKBUSYFREEREAD_IR0x0b//讀取紅外define0x0c//保存數(shù)據(jù)define0x0d//讀取鍵值defineSENDIRHEADTAILSDAP1_7define//接受數(shù)據(jù)緩沖unsigned intbuf1_length。//發(fā)送數(shù)據(jù)緩沖unsigned intbuf2_length。//接收標(biāo)志,1表示接受到一個數(shù)據(jù)幀,0表示沒有接受到數(shù)據(jù)幀或數(shù)據(jù)幀為空bit buf2_flag。union{unsigned char a[2]。unsigned char data *p1[2]。unsigned char xdata *p3。}p。////unsigned char a[2]。////unsigned int b。//unsigned int data *p2[2]。//unsigned int xdata *p4。//地址指針//}q。unsigned char a[2]。unsigned int b。union{}temp。unsigned char a[4]。unsigned int b[2]。unsigned long c。union{}I。bit ir_flag。void delay(void)。void tf_0(void)。void tf_1(void)。void read_ir(void)。void ir_init(void)。void store_ir(void)。void reset_iic(void)。unsigned char read_byte_nack_iic(void)。void send_ack_iic(void)。bit receive_ack_iic(void)。void stop_iic(void)。unsigned int read_key_data(unsigned char a)。interrupt 0{ie_
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1